天哪!几行js代码就可以实现拳皇小游戏
发布时间:2025-11-04 04:12:45 作者:玩站小弟
我要评论
前言今天,我们用原生JS实现一个拳皇人物位置控制的小效果。话不多说,我们赶紧来看下如何实现吧!效果(非静止八神)分别按W、S、A、D键可实现位置移动,并且效果真实。源码html与css很简单,主要是j
。
前言
今天,天行我们用原生JS实现一个拳皇人物位置控制的代码小效果。话不多说,可实我们赶紧来看下如何实现吧!
效果

(非静止八神)
分别按W、现拳S、游戏A、天行D键可实现位置移动,代码并且效果真实。免费信息发布网可实
源码
html与css很简单,现拳主要是游戏js中有几点需要注意的。
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>游戏动作控制(设计模式)</title> <style> *{ margin: 0; padding: 0; } html{ height:100%; background: url(images/bg.jpg) no-repeat; background-size:100% 100%; } #site{ height: 100%; } img{ position: absolute; bottom: 50px; width: 200px; height: 350px; } </style> </head> <body> <div id="site"> <img src="images/YAGAMI/stand.gif" alt="" id="MC" data-name="n1"> </div> </body> <script type="text/javascript"> var pl=document.getElementById("MC"); var i=1; // 行为表 var skill={ "n1":{ "d1":function(){ console.log("前进"); play.getImg().src="images/YAGAMI/advance.gif" play.getImg().style.left=i+"px" },天行 "d2":function(){ console.log("后退"); play.getImg().src="images/YAGAMI/retreat.gif" }, "d3":function(){ console.log("站立"); play.getImg().src="images/YAGAMI/stand.gif" }, "d4":function(){ console.log("暴起"); play.getImg().src="images/YAGAMI/bq.gif" } } } //键位表 var active={ "68":"d1", "65":"d2", "83":"d3", "87":"d4" } // 操作 function set(obj,key){ if(!active[key])return; return function(){ var name=obj.getName(); skill[name][active[key]](); } } // 创建一个Play类 function Play(pl){ var imgNade =pl; var name=pl.getAttribute("data-name"); this.getImg=function(){ return imgNade; } this.getName=function(){ return name; } } var play=new Play(pl); // 按下 document.onkeydown=function(e){ i+=10; var key=e.keyCode; var fu=set(play,key); if(fu){ fu(); } } </script> </html>源码地址
源码如下,大家可以按照这个思路丰富下效果,代码实现一个完整的可实拳皇游戏。WordPress模板
https://github.com/maomincoding/game_kz.git
结语
谢谢阅读,现拳希望没有浪费您的游戏时间。这篇文章篇幅较短,主要是给大家实现一个小效果。

相关文章
电脑主题安装密码错误的解决方法(忘记或输入错误密码时如何解决电脑主题安装问题)
摘要:在进行电脑主题安装过程中,有时候我们会遇到密码错误的问题。这可能是因为我们忘记了密码,或者是输入了错误的密码。无论是哪种情况,这都会导致我们无法正常地安装所需的电脑主题。为了帮助大...2025-11-04
网络安全公司 Radware 披露针对 ChatGPT 的零点击数据窃取攻击
ShadowLeak攻击技术分析Radware安全研究人员发现了一种针对ChatGPT的服务器端数据窃取攻击,命名为ShadowLeak。专家在ChatGPT的Deep Research深度研究)代理2025-11-04
TiDB 是一个分布式 NewSQL 数据库。它支持水平弹性扩展、ACID 事务、标准 SQL、MySQL 语法和 MySQL 协议,具有数据强一致的高可用特性,是一个不仅适合 OLTP 场景还适合2025-11-04
由于消费电子设备的不断增长以及对低功耗、高性能和节能连接产品的需求,消费者和企业部门对物联网连接的需求不断上升,预计到2028年, MCU 市场价值将达到60亿美元。微控制器单元2025-11-04Win764位安装教程(轻松学会Win764位系统的安装与设置)
摘要:随着技术的不断发展,Win764位系统已经成为许多计算机用户的首选操作系统。然而,对于一些没有安装经验的用户来说,可能会感到困惑和无措。本文将提供一份详细的Win764位安装教程,...2025-11-04
在COVID-19大流行之后,全球供应链正遭受前所未有的破坏,平均每家大企业报告的年收入损失为1.82亿美元。但许多供应链挑战早在过去几年的混乱之前就出现了。国内和全球供应链的数字化转型姗姗来迟。提高2025-11-04

最新评论